/\u003e\u003c/a\u003e\u003c/p\u003e\n\n\u003c!-- readme-package-icons end --\u003e\n\n## ⚡ Description\n\nThis github action generates testing coverage badges from a coverage summary and pushes them to the repo at `./badges`. There is five badges generated:\n\n![Branches](./badges/coverage-branches.svg)\n![Functions](./badges/coverage-functions.svg)\n![Lines](./badges/coverage-lines.svg)\n![Statements](./badges/coverage-statements.svg)\n![Coverage total](./badges/coverage-total.svg)\n\nYou can use them on a readme like so:\n\n```markdown\n![Branches](./badges/coverage-branches.svg)\n![Functions](./badges/coverage-functions.svg)\n![Lines](./badges/coverage-lines.svg)\n![Statements](./badges/coverage-statements.svg)\n![Coverage total](./badges/coverage-total.svg)\n```\n\n## ⚡ Requirements\n\nYou will need to add json-summary to coverage reporters in your test runner config. You will also need to run your tests suite before calling this action in your ci workflow. See `usage` for an example.\n\n### 🔶 vitest\n\n`vite config`\n\n```typescript\nimport { defineConfig } from 'vitest/config';\n\nexport default defineConfig({\n  test: {\n    coverage: {\n      reporter: ['json-summary'],\n      // ...\n    },\n  },\n});\n```\n\n### 🔶 jest\n\n`jest config`\n\n```javascript\nmodule.exports = {\n   coverageReporters: [\"json-summary\"];\n   // ...\n};\n```\n\n## ⚡ Inputs\n\n### 🔶 `no-commit`\n\nIf set to `true`, badges won't be committed by the github action.\n\n\u003e Default value: **false**\n\n### 🔶 `branches`\n\nBranches on which the badges should be generated, separated by commas. Optionally, you can set the value as `*` to specify generation should always happen.\n\n\u003e Default value: **master,main**\n\n### 🔶 `target-branch`\n\nThe branch on which generated badges should be pushed. If unset, the current branch (on which the action is ran against) will be used.\n\n### 🔶 `coverage-summary-path`\n\nJest coverage summary paths (json-summary). Defining this may be useful if you need to run this action on a monorepo. Can be an array of glob paths.\n\n\u003e Default value:\n\n```yaml |\n./coverage/coverage-summary.json\n```\n\n### 🔶 `badges-icon`\n\nThe icon to use for the badges, as a simple icons slug. You can find slugs [here](https://simpleicons.org/).\n\n\u003e Default is [file-icons:test-generic](https://icon-sets.iconify.design/file-icons/test-generic/).\n\n### 🔶 `badges-labels-prefix`\n\nLabel prefix for the generated badges text. For example if you use `Repo test coverage`, generated badges will have a label matching `Repo test coverage: {key}` where `key = 'total' | 'lines' | 'statements' | 'functions' | 'branches'`.\n\n\u003e Default value: **`Test coverage: `**\n\n### 🔶 `commit-message`\n\nCommit message of the commit with generated badges.\n\n\u003e Default value: **Updating coverage badges**\n\n### 🔶 `commit-user`\n\nCustomizing the name of the user committing generated badges (optional).\n\n\u003e Default value: **\u003ccontext.actor\u003e**\n\n### 🔶 `commit-user-email`\n\nCustomizing the email of the user committing generated badges (optional).\n\n\u003e Default value: **\u003ccontext.actor\u003e@users.noreply.github.com**\n\n### 🔶 `output-folder`\n\nWhere badges should be written (optional).\n\n\u003e Default value: **./badges**\n\n## ⚡ Usage\n\nLet's first define an npm script to run jest in package.json, specifying the coverage option to generate a coverage report:\n\n```json\n{\n  \"scripts\": {\n    // in case you use jest\n    \"test-ci\": \"jest --ci --coverage\",\n    // or if you use vitest ...\n    \"test-ci\": \"vitest --coverage --run\"\n  }\n}\n```\n\nLet's then define our workflow:\n\n```yaml\nname: ⚡ My ci things\n\non: [push]\n\njobs:\n  my-workflow:\n    name: 📣 Generate cool badges\n    runs-on: ubuntu-latest\n    steps:\n\n    # Necessary to push the generated badges to the repo\n    - name: ⬇️ Checkout repo\n      uses: actions/checkout@08c6903cd8c0fde910a37f88322edcfb5dd907a8 # v5.0.0\n\n    # ...\n\n    # Necessary to generate the coverage report.\n    # Make sure to add 'json-summary' to the coverageReporters in jest options\n    - name: 🔍 Tests\n      run: yarn test-ci\n\n    - name: ⚙️ Generating coverage badges\n      uses: jpb06/coverage-badges-action@latest\n        with:\n          branches: master,preprod,staging\n          badges-icon: vitest\n\n```\n\nThe badges will be generated when the action runs on the master, preprod or staging branch.\n\n### 🔶 Using a custom jest coverage summary file path\n\nIn case you need to define a custom path for the coverage summary file, you can use the `coverage-summary-path` input like so:\n\n```yaml\n    [...]\n    - name: ⚙️ Generating coverage badges\n      uses: jpb06/coverage-badges-action@latest\n        with:\n          coverage-summary-path: |\n            ./my-module/coverage/coverage-summary.json\n```\n\n### 🔶 Generating badges from several subpaths for `coverage-summary-path` to generate badges from several reports (several apps in a monorepo for example):\n\nYou may use an array of wildcard glob paths when you want to generate badges for several summary reports. In the example, we will generate a set of badges for each app in our monorepo:\n\n```yaml\n    [...]\n    - name: ⚙️ Generating coverage badges\n      uses: jpb06/coverage-badges-action@latest\n        with:\n          coverage-summary-path: |\n            ./apps/**/coverage/coverage-summary.json\n            ./libs/**/coverage/coverage-summary.json\n```\n\nBadges will be written in subfolders following the captured glob path folder structure.\nSo for example if we have three apps defined as `apps/front/auth`, `apps/front/dashboard` and `apps/back`, the generated folder structure would look like:\n\n```bash\n# Coverage badges for the auth frontend app\n./badges/front/auth/*\n\n# Coverage badges for the dashboard frontend app\n./badges/front/dashboard/*\n\n# Coverage badges for the backend app\n./badges/back/*\n```\n\n### 🔶 Pushing generated badges to a custom branch\n\nYour perpetual branches should be protected to avoid some people from force pushing on them for example.
